One year less than thirty years ago, in March 1947, Biblionews, unannounced, and perhaps unwelcome in some quarters because of its lack of distinction, was mailed to members of the Book Collectors’ Society which had already exceeded the life span predicted for it by various individuals— six months, they said, it would last. What they overlooked was that its nucleus was a group of collectors which gathered regularly each Saturday afternoon in the back of Buddy Larsen’s Bond Street bookshop to munch a pie and drink a cup of tea and show off the morning’s trophies—not that they amounted to much in the dark days of World War II. But talk we did and sometimes of a Book Collectors’ Society; but some grew tired of talking and sent out invitations to people we knew who might be interested, inviting them to an inaugural meeting. That was in April 1944.
